Sunday Planes

Sunday planes
Flying low
Through your hair
Soft and slow
We are alive
Let’s take a ride

Absurdity
Sing to me
There’s still an ambulance
Waiting for me
Beyond another
Dreamt summer

And should we part
Without a goodbye
Know you were more than enough
For a reason why
My faithful skeptic
For the rest of it

I’ll find the sweetness between
Optimism and delirium
In an empire on its knees
No longer high on helium
Without an identity
Beyond the taught and bought
Upon the cereal stained textbook page
Describing the battles we fought

Sunday brain
Power-saving mode
I’ve stopped seeing birds
Flying alone
In the blue Queens sky
Of our collective mind

Ghosts in the street
Serenade me
I’m only writing prayers
No more prophecy
Of the mercurial light
Only redefined night

Ambitions fade
Seasons leave
The flowers grow again
Before the dirt can grieve
In a clearing by the sea
Where you once held me

I’ll lean on the abstract read
Of my most contradictory components
I have little use for attention seeking
‘Nor fetishizing aloneness
If that passes for dignity
Then hell, sign me up
I’m always somewhere in the multiverse
Singing about love
